Size

When choosing an in-built oven or microwave the size of your kitchen is important. You can choose between different sizes and capacities, [Redirect Only] whether you're looking for an appliance that is placed above the range or one that is built beneath the counter. A smaller capacity appliance may be suitable for a single user, however, larger models work best for families that cook large meals and prepare several batches per day.

The model that is over-the-range sits above your stove. It is available in a variety of sizes to fit standard openings in cabinets. To determine which size will fit your space, measure the width and height of your empty cabinet cutout and refer to the specifications of the manufacturer for precise dimensions. Make sure to include the width inside and the full extension of the cabinet door when it is closed.

Under-counter microwaves usually sit on a countertop beneath your sink. They are available in different designs and colors with some of them seamlessly into the kitchen island to create a sleeker look. Certain models come with touch controls that make it simple to set the desired cooking time.

The exterior dimensions and height of a microwave oven builtin are important aspects to consider. A bigger and more tall model will take up more counter space, whereas smaller and slimmer models can fit into smaller spaces. The depth of the exterior of a microwave is essential, since it's required for proper ventilation when you use the appliance.

Microwaves that are placed over the range or on a counter are usually plugged into an electrical outlet. However the built-in models are inserted inside a cabinet or drawer and require professional installation. Some models require venting, or a trim kit to make a seamless appearance.

Power

A microwave is an efficient appliance that is able to quickly and easily reheat food or cook meals from scratch. Microwaves can be found in various sizes and power levels depending on your budget and requirements. You can pick from a variety of features to simplify cooking.

A conventional microwave makes use of electromagnetic waves to cook food items. It is ideal for defrosting leftovers or heating leftover foods. On the other hand, a convection microwave can be used to bake or roast foods. Its heating process is similar to an oven, making it a suitable option for cooking more complicated dishes.

The power of a microwave is measured in watts. The more powerful the wattage, the quicker it will cook the food. Some models offer sensors for cooking, defrost, and defrost settings to save you time.

The lifespan of a micro-wave oven is determined by its use, maintenance, and the adherence to care guidelines. With regular use and a careful handling the microwave can last between 10 and 15 years.

Choosing the right microwave for your home requires contemplating how often you'll be using it and also the requirements for installation. While it's possible to install a countertop microwave on your own, you'll likely need professional assistance for built-in microwaves that integrate into your kitchen design.
